Brief Description:  Left Fuel Tank #16 - Install Baffle

After much dry running, double checking, and thorough cleaning, I finally closed up the fuel tank by sealing on the baffle. I used the plastic bag method in laying down a nice bead of sealant along the forward edge of the tank skin rivet lines and inboard/outboard ribs, globbed a bunch of sealant in the corners, thinly smeared sealant around the interior rib holes, and droppped the baffle into place. I made sure the skin/baffle holes were aligned, and 100% clekoed all the holes. Then I properly positioned and clekoed all the z-brakets and baffle/rib holes. I then installed all the pull rivets in the back of baffle and z-brackets after swirling them in sealant. Finally, I covered all the pulled rivet heads in sealant, cleaned up, and called it a night.
